我的linux宝塔面板安装php出现了问题
时间 : 2024-01-15 01:58: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在安装Linux宝塔面板时,遇到问题是很常见的。其中,安装PHP时可能会遇到一些困难。以下是一些常见的问题和解决方案,希望能帮助你解决这个问题。

1. PHP版本不兼容:在安装PHP时,确保所选择的PHP版本与你的操作系统兼容。宝塔面板通常支持多个PHP版本,选择合适的版本是非常重要的。你可以在宝塔面板的软件管理中找到可用的PHP版本。

解决方法:在宝塔面板的软件管理中选择一个与你的操作系统兼容的PHP版本,并进行安装。

2. 安装依赖错误:PHP安装过程中可能会遇到依赖错误,缺少一些必需的库和组件。

解决方法:根据错误提示,安装缺少的库和组件。你可以使用apt或yum命令来安装缺少的依赖项。例如,如果你使用的是Ubuntu操作系统,可以通过以下命令安装一些常见的依赖项:

sudo apt-get install libapache2-mod-php

sudo apt-get install php-mysql

sudo apt-get install php-curl

3. 配置问题:PHP安装后,可能需要对其进行一些配置。例如,你可能需要通过修改php.ini文件来更改一些PHP的默认设置。

解决方法:找到php.ini文件,通常它位于/etc/php/目录下。编辑该文件并进行需要的修改。对于某些修改,你可能需要重启Web服务器或php-fpm服务以使其生效。

4. 权限问题:在PHP安装过程中,出现权限问题是很常见的。

解决方法:确保你有足够的权限来执行PHP安装操作。通常,你需要使用root用户或具有sudo权限的用户来进行PHP安装。

以上是一些常见的问题和解决方法,希望能帮助你解决安装PHP遇到的问题。如果你还是遇到困难,建议你参考宝塔面板的官方文档或向其官方技术支持寻求帮助。

其他答案

在安装Linux宝塔面板时,可能会遇到一些问题,其中一个常见的问题是安装PHP时出现错误。下面将为您提供一些可能的解决方法:

1. 检查软件源:首先,确认您的系统软件源配置是否正确。在终端中输入以下命令来更新软件源:

sudo apt-get update

这将更新系统中的软件源列表。

2. 重新安装软件:如果您已经安装了PHP,但仍然遇到问题,可以尝试重新安装PHP。在终端中输入以下命令来重新安装PHP:

sudo apt-get remove php

sudo apt-get install php

这将卸载并重新安装PHP。

3. 检查依赖关系:安装PHP时可能会依赖其他软件包。确保您的系统中所有PHP所需的依赖关系都已正确安装。您可以使用以下命令来检查并安装缺少的依赖关系:

sudo apt-get install -f

这将自动查找并安装缺少的依赖关系。

4. 查看错误日志:如果您仍然无法解决问题,可以查看PHP的错误日志,以了解导致安装失败的具体原因。错误日志通常位于/var/log/目录中,名为php_error.log或类似的文件。使用以下命令来打开错误日志文件:

sudo nano /var/log/php_error.log

在这个文件中,您可以查看PHP安装期间发生的错误和警告消息。

如果上述方法仍无法解决问题,您可以尝试在Linux宝塔面板的官方论坛或社区提问,寻求更详细的帮助。在发帖时,提供详细的错误信息和您所使用的系统版本将有助于其他社区成员更好地帮助您解决问题。

总之,通过检查软件源、重新安装软件、检查依赖关系和查看错误日志,您有望解决Linux宝塔面板安装PHP时遇到的问题。祝您成功!